Understanding an Angina Diagnosis

Bosnian ↔ EnglishHealth12 segments ≈241 wordsSegments of 35 words or fewer

Cardiologist (speaking English) and Patient (speaking Bosnian) talk through “Understanding an Angina Diagnosis”. You interpret both ways — English into Bosnian, and Bosnian into English — one segment at a time, exactly as in the CCL test.

Full transcript

SEGMENT 1 · ENGLISH · 24 WORDS
Cardiologist

Your ECG and symptoms suggest angina, meaning the heart muscle isn't getting enough oxygen-rich blood, usually from narrowed arteries, which we can manage well.

SEGMENT 2 · BOSNIAN · 20 WORDS
Patient

Šta tačno znači angina? Da li je to isto što i srčani udar, i šta se tačno dešava tokom testa opterećenja?

SEGMENT 3 · ENGLISH · 30 WORDS
Cardiologist

Angina is chest pain from reduced blood flow; a heart attack means blocked flow damaging tissue permanently. The stress test safely monitors your heart while you walk on a treadmill.

SEGMENT 4 · BOSNIAN · 20 WORDS
Patient

Razumijem, hvala na objašnjenju. Da li smijem piti kafu ujutru, ili to može pogoršati simptome?

SEGMENT 5 · ENGLISH · 24 WORDS
Cardiologist

You can have one moderate coffee daily unless it triggers chest tightness; if it does, switch to decaf. Let's now book your stress test.

SEGMENT 6 · BOSNIAN · 20 WORDS
Patient

Hvala vam. A šta je sa onim sprejom, GTN sprejom? Kako tačno da ga koristim ako osjetim bol u grudima?

SEGMENT 7 · ENGLISH · 20 WORDS
Cardiologist

Spray one dose under your tongue when pain starts; if it doesn't ease within five minutes, call triple zero immediately.

SEGMENT 8 · BOSNIAN · 15 WORDS
Patient

Da li smijem voziti auto ili raditi dok čekam na taj test, ili treba da mirujem?

SEGMENT 9 · ENGLISH · 21 WORDS
Cardiologist

You may keep working and driving normally, provided you don't ignore chest pain; stop immediately and rest if any symptoms occur.

SEGMENT 10 · BOSNIAN · 11 WORDS
Patient

Kada je zakazan taj test i gdje se obavlja?

SEGMENT 11 · ENGLISH · 20 WORDS
Cardiologist

Your stress test is booked for Thursday at 9:30 am at Box Hill Hospital; please arrive thirty minutes early, fasting.

SEGMENT 12 · BOSNIAN · 16 WORDS
Patient

Hvala vam puno, doktore, sada mi je mnogo jasnije. Doći ću tačno na vrijeme.
